Transaction

e7a35e818f6b8099c2c06fe124468961d6a81c19e2c8c80c1c6ea124d71faffc
308,760 confirmations
Timestamp
1590500176
Block631,777
Fee10,878 sats
Fee rate75.5 sats/vB
view on mempool.space

Inputs & Outputs